Pachter: Wii U price cut next year
Following today’s launch details, he’s unleashed a barrage of tweets about the info. “ think Nintendo is pricing right, will capitalize on fervent fans who will buy at this price,” he said. Those are probably the kindest words he’s ever said about the console.

His kindness continues as he mentions that he likes the launch lineup that he sees: “The Wii U software lineup was better than I expected, third party support pretty solid, and Nintendo titles high quality.”

Still, Pachter did say that he expects 2013 to see a price cut for the machine, as competitive PS3 and Xbox 360 deals come to the fore.
